Vikas Swarup (* 1963 in Allahabad) ist ein indischer Diplomat und Schriftsteller. Er schrieb den Bestseller Q and A, was für questions and answers (Fragen und Antworten) steht und den deutschen Titel Rupien! Rupien! trägt. Hierbei handelt es sich um einen Roman über einen armen indischen Kellner, der in einer Quizshow eine Milliarde Rupien gewinnt und dann auf Grund des Verdachts auf Betrug im Gefängnis landet. Zu seinem Buch wurde Swarup nach eigener Aussage durch einen Besuch einer der Lernstationen des Bildungsprojektes Hole in the Wall inspiriert. Das Buch wurde 2005 veröffentlicht, ist inzwischen in fast 30 Sprachen übersetzt und wurde unter dem Titel Slumdog Millionär (2008) verfilmt. Der Film wurde mit insgesamt acht Oscars ausgezeichnet.

(fr) Vikas Swarup (born 22 June 1961) is a retired Indian diplomat and writer. He retired from the Indian Foreign Service as the Secretary (West) at the Ministry of External Affairs, India on 30 June 2021 and has previously served as High Commissioner of India in Canada and has been the official spokesperson of the Ministry of External Affairs. He was best known as the author of the novel Q & A, adapted in film as Slumdog Millionaire, the winner of Best Film for the year 2009 at the Academy Awards, Golden Globe Awards and BAFTA Awards. Swarup joined the Indian Foreign Service in 1986 and served in Turkey, the United States, Ethiopia, the United Kingdom, South Africa and Japan in various Indian diplomatic missions. His other novels are Six Suspects and The Accidental Apprentice. In April 2015, he was appointed as the official spokesperson of the Ministry of External Affairs of India to head its Public Diplomacy divisions at New Delhi, succeeding Syed Akbaruddin. In December 2019, Swarup took charge as Secretary (West) in the Ministry of External Affairs, looking after relations with Europe, Central Asia as well as the United Nations system.
